M G 31 (Glipizide and Metformin Hydrochloride 2.5 mg / 250 mg)
Pill with imprint M G 31 is White, Round and has been identified as Glipizide and Metformin Hydrochloride 2.5 mg / 250 mg. It is supplied by Mylan Pharmaceuticals Inc..
Glipizide/metformin is used in the treatment of diabetes, type 2 and belongs to the drug class antidiabetic combinations. Risk cannot be ruled out during pregnancy. Glipizide/metformin 2.5 mg / 250 mg is not a controlled substance under the Controlled Substances Act (CSA).
